Bernstein joins Colliers ABR as vice chairman
January 4, 2008 - Brokerage
According to Colliers ABR, Inc., a leading full service commercial real estate services firm, Richard Bernstein has been named vice chairman. Bernstein will play an integral role in the expansion of the business, particularly in the area of transaction management, and will help guide the strategic direction of the firm.
Prior to joining Colliers ABR, Bernstein was president at Trammell Crow New York, where he was responsible for arranging leasing and equity transactions for significant clients such as JPMorgan Chase & Co., Random House, Coty, King & Spalding and The Chubb Corp.
Bernstein is a graduate of Hofstra University with a bachelor of science in Economics.
